CVE-2024-39778 — When a stateless virtual server is configured on BIG-IP system with a High-Speed

When a stateless virtual server is configured on BIG-IP system with a High-Speed Bridge (HSB), undisclosed requests can cause TMM to terminate.

01What is this vulnerability?

When a stateless virtual server is configured on BIG-IP system with a High-Speed Bridge (HSB), undisclosed requests can cause TMM to terminate.

02Affected products

VendorProductVersions
F5BIGIP — 17.1.0, 16.1.0, 15.1.0
